Leo Delegates Extradition of Georgia's Killer Kid to Josh

Leo swiftly pivots from Josh's lobby sit-in report, briefing him on a 13-year-old Georgia boy who murdered his teacher and fled to Rome, arrested by Interpol. With Italy refusing extradition over U.S. death penalty concerns, Leo escalates it to a White House crisis, tasking Josh with diplomatic maneuvering. Josh's flippant Italian quip draws Leo's sharp rebuke, enforcing professionalism and underscoring the subplot's high-stakes setup amid holiday pressures.
